#e32366 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e32366 is composed of 89% red, 13.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.6%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 339.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 51.4%. #e32366 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46cc with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e32366 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e32366 has RGB values of R:227, G:35,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.55,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14885734.

Shades and Tints of #e32366
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060103 is the darkest color, while #fef4f7 is the lightest one.
